9.02.170 - Definitions.

Definitions.

For purposes of this chapter:

     (1) "Viability" means the point in the pregnancy when, in the judgment of the physician on the particular facts of the case before such physician, there is a reasonable likelihood of the fetus's sustained survival outside the uterus without the application of extraordinary medical measures.

     (2) "Abortion" means any medical treatment intended to induce the termination of a pregnancy except for the purpose of producing a live birth.

     (3) "Pregnancy" means the reproductive process beginning with the implantation of an embryo.

     (4) "Physician" means a physician licensed to practice under chapter 18.57 or 18.71 RCW in the state of Washington.

     (5) "Health care provider" means a physician or a person acting under the general direction of a physician.

     (6) "State" means the state of Washington and counties, cities, towns, municipal corporations, and quasi-municipal corporations in the state of Washington.

     (7) "Private medical facility" means any medical facility that is not owned or operated by the state.

[1992 c 1 § 8 (Initiative Measure No. 120, approved November 5, 1991).]
